Step‑by‑Step: How a Withdrawal Is Processed

Understanding the workflow demystifies any delays. Generally, the process follows these stages:

  1. Request Submission: You log into the casino, pick “Withdraw”, choose a method and amount.
  2. Automated Check: The system verifies that the amount is eligible (e.g., wagering requirements met).
  3. KYC Review: If it’s your first withdrawal or a large sum, you’ll be asked for ID, proof of address and possibly a source‑of‑funds document.
  4. Internal Approval: The finance team gives the final green light. Some casinos approve within minutes, others batch requests nightly.
  5. Transfer to Provider: Money moves to your eWallet or bank. The provider then completes the last leg to your account.

Key Factors That Can Slow Down a Payout

Even with a fast‑track casino, a few things can stretch the timeline. Being aware helps you avoid surprises.

  • Incomplete Verification: Missing a photo ID or utility bill will trigger a manual review.
  • Unmet Wagering Requirements: Bonuses often come with a “play through” condition; withdrawals before it’s satisfied are blocked.
  • High‑Value Withdrawals: Large sums may be flagged for anti‑money‑laundering checks, adding 24‑48 hours.
  • Bank Holidays: Australian public holidays pause processing for bank transfers.
  • Out‑of‑Date Payment Details: A typo in your account number forces the casino to reject the request.

Tips to Speed Up Your Withdrawal

Here are practical steps you can take right after registration to keep the payout line moving:

  • Complete the KYC verification before you even place a bet. Upload a clear scan of your driver’s licence and a recent utility bill.
  • Choose an eWallet as your primary payout method; they consistently outrun banks in speed.
  • Read the bonus terms carefully. Finish any wagering requirements on a low‑variance game to free up funds faster.
  • Keep your personal details up to date in the casino’s account settings – especially your phone number for 2‑factor authentication.
  • When withdrawing large amounts, split the request into two smaller batches if the casino allows it.
